**Break-Glass Access — Plannerhawk Regression Response.** When the Plannerhawk query planner regresses and normal rollback tooling is unavailable, contractors may invoke break-glass access to pin the prior plan cache. This requires approval from the on-call lead at Corvane Systems and is fully audited. After approval, the break-glass console asks for the recovery passphrase shown below.

recovery phrase for tawef-hawif: praiel-novvan-frador-soriel-novath-pelath

Ticket: Config drift on the Haldane garage occupancy feed. The Ostermill node is publishing counts every 5s while the other three garages publish every 15s, which skews the aggregation window downstream in Lotgrid. Someone hot-patched the interval during the holiday surge and never reverted. Please review the diff and restore parity across all nodes. The intended baseline configuration is as follows.

settings of kahip-hafop:
ralix:
  log_level: warn
  metrics_host: metrics.ralix.zemvarsys.internal
  pin: 8273
  pool_size: 8

// Order cutoff logic for Flourhouse storefront.
// Orders placed after cutoff roll to the next bake day; Sundays
// are skipped entirely. Holiday overrides live in the schedule
// service, not here. Don't change these without checking with the
// Millbrook kitchen lead first. Current production values are as
follows.

limits module of kahag-fajop:
QUOTAS = {
    "wenwyn": 10,
    "zorath": 1,
}

/*
 * Fixture: rate_parity_mismatch_basic
 *
 * Simulates the Tarnwick rate-parity checker finding a hotel whose
 * direct-site price undercuts the aggregator feed by 4%. Support team:
 * when a customer reports a false mismatch, replay their property ID
 * through this fixture first — it exercises currency rounding, which
 * causes most false positives. The fixture hits the staging comparison
 * endpoint, so authentication is required; the staging bearer token is
 * pasted directly below this comment block.
 */

session JWT of tadup-kaguf = eyJhbGciOiJIUzI1NiIsInR5cCI6IkpXVCJ9.eyJzdWIiOiItNz4V3In0.KrZCeqpk